Today many complex systems are built starting from certain prior products. Traditional cost estimation methods assuming products are built from scratch and using simple methods such as linear regressions can lead to significant errors. This paper studies the switching costs, the costs of developing a new product that is built based upon a previously developed product. It presents a series of systematic study results including its concept, properties, an estimation method, and operation principles. Our approach is an automated method that is able to minimize manual efforts. It can leverage historical data, acquisition information, existing cost models, commercial costing tools, and Expert Judgments (EJ). An HVAC (Heating, Ventilation, and Air Conditioning) system design example case was used to demonstrate our approach.
